How Can I Help my Community Library?

Although the Library is tax supported, it is one of the smallest library districts in Colorado. Thus, the Library District relies a great deal on donations for between 20-30% of the annual budget.

What Can I Give?

Gifts of Time

The gift of time is invaluable to our  Library District and our Friends of the Library group. We welcome volunteers on a variety of projects: book and product sales, circulation desk, shelving, Boards, gardening, etc.  Contact us at 970-881-2664.

Gifts of Cash

The convenience of giving cash gifts makes it the most popular means of support.  A cancelled check or a receipt can document your contribution.

Memorial Donations

Memorials in the form of cash or other giving are a time-honored way of recognizing family, friends, and cherished community members. A Memorial Board in the Library is available with engraved plates for memorial gifts of over $25.

Gifts of Materials

The Library welcomes and accepts donations of new books and materials, as well as gently used books and materials. All material donations are checked for addition to the Library’s collection and are a welcome contribution for the Friends of the Library Book Sales. The Library also appreciates donations of office supplies such as ink cartridges, copy paper, envelopes and other supplies (please check with Library Director for more information).

Gifts of Securities and Real Estate

Gifts of securities or real estate often confer significant tax benefits on a donor. Contributions of appreciated assets held for over a year may be deductible at market value, and capital gains tax may be avoided through such a gift.

IRAs

Charitable gifts may be a way to minimize tax consequences resulting from required IRA distributions.

Bequests and Life Insurance

You can make the library a beneficiary in your will, or the beneficiary of a new or existing life insurance policy.

Matching Employer Contributions

Many businesses, corporations and organizations have matching gift or contribution programs that will double, and in some cases triple, individual contributions to a qualified nonprofit organization. Check with your employer to find out if they match your donations, and then contact us for our tax ID number.
